The amount of yawing moment that the … WebDec 31, 2024 · The boiling point of a liquid is the temperature such that the liquid's vapor pressure is equal to the atmospheric pressure. When you go to a higher altitude, the boiling point is lower not because the vapor pressure of the liquid at a given temperature has changed, but because there is less atmospheric pressure.

WebAt any altitude, the atmospheric pressure must more or less bear the weight of the air above that altitude. Mathematically, this can be expressed as the hydrostatic equilibrium condition d p / d z = − ρ g, where p, ρ, and g are the pressure, density, and gravitational acceleration at altitude z. So if you capture the change in one, you capture the change in the other, it seems---unless the specific impulse depends on still other variables not accounted for in the change in thrust. desk chair roller wheels for carpetWebLift does not change with altitude. As long as the aircraft flies straight and level (or 1g) lift is always equal to weight no matter what altitude.
